Re: Creating folders for non users

2008-03-19 Thread Bob Marcan
On Wed, 19 Mar 2008 11:05:38 +0200
Nikos Gatsis [EMAIL PROTECTED] wrote:

 Hello list.
 I have a strange problem, with cyrus.
 If system receive a message for a non existing user, cyrus creating this 
 user and folders inbox,send etc.
 
 I use sendmail-8.14.2-1.fc8 and cyrus-imapd-2.3.9-7.fc8.
 
 My imapd.conf is:
 
 configdirectory: /var/lib/imap
 partition-default: /var/spool/imap
 admins: cyrus admin
 allowanonymouslogin: no
 allowplaintext: yes
 anyoneuseracl: 0
 autocreatequota: 20480
 quotawarn: 90

 createonpost: yes
^
imapd.conf.5
createonpost: 0
  If  yes,  when  lmtpd  receives an incoming mail for an INBOX 
that
  does not exist, then the INBOX is automatically created by  
lmtpd.

 autocreateinboxfolders: Sent|Drafts|Trash
 maxmessagesize: 7168000
 sievedir: /var/lib/imap/sieve
 sendmail: /usr/sbin/sendmail
 hashimapspool: true
 sasl_pwcheck_method: saslauthd
 sasl_mech_list: PLAIN
 tls_cert_file: /etc/pki/cyrus-imapd/cyrus-imapd.pem
 tls_key_file: /etc/pki/cyrus-imapd/cyrus-imapd.pem
 tls_ca_file: /etc/pki/tls/certs/ca-bundle.crt
 
 
 How can I stop this?
 
 Thank you, Nikos
 
 Cyrus Home Page: http://cyrusimap.web.cmu.edu/
 Cyrus Wiki/FAQ: http://cyrusimap.web.cmu.edu/twiki
 List Archives/Info: http://asg.web.cmu.edu/cyrus/mailing-list.html

Cyrus Home Page: http://cyrusimap.web.cmu.edu/
Cyrus Wiki/FAQ: http://cyrusimap.web.cmu.edu/twiki
List Archives/Info: http://asg.web.cmu.edu/cyrus/mailing-list.html


Re: Creating folders for non users

2008-03-19 Thread Bob Marcan
On Wed, 19 Mar 2008 13:54:18 +0200
Nikos Gatsis [EMAIL PROTECTED] wrote:

 That won't cause any trouble to new users?
 
 Bob Marcan wrote:
  On Wed, 19 Mar 2008 11:05:38 +0200
  Nikos Gatsis [EMAIL PROTECTED] wrote:
 

  Hello list.
  I have a strange problem, with cyrus.
  If system receive a message for a non existing user, cyrus creating this 
  user and folders inbox,send etc.
 
  I use sendmail-8.14.2-1.fc8 and cyrus-imapd-2.3.9-7.fc8.
 
  My imapd.conf is:
 
  configdirectory: /var/lib/imap
  partition-default: /var/spool/imap
  admins: cyrus admin
  allowanonymouslogin: no
  allowplaintext: yes
  anyoneuseracl: 0
  autocreatequota: 20480
  quotawarn: 90
  
 

  createonpost: yes
  
  ^
  imapd.conf.5
  createonpost: 0
If  yes,  when  lmtpd  receives an incoming mail for an INBOX 
  that
does not exist, then the INBOX is automatically created by  
  lmtpd.
 

  autocreateinboxfolders: Sent|Drafts|Trash

Depends.
1. Add new user with cyradm.
autocreateinboxfolders will still create mailboxes

2. If you want to use this feature, prevent delivery to nonexistent
cyrus user at MTA level.
Regards, Bob

P.S.
Please, don't top post.

A: Because it messes up the order in which people normally read text.
Q: Why is top-posting such a bad thing?
A: Top-posting.
Q: What is the most annoying thing in e-mail?
http://en.wikipedia.org/wiki/Top-posting#Top-posting


Cyrus Home Page: http://cyrusimap.web.cmu.edu/
Cyrus Wiki/FAQ: http://cyrusimap.web.cmu.edu/twiki
List Archives/Info: http://asg.web.cmu.edu/cyrus/mailing-list.html


Weird cyrus user

2007-05-17 Thread Bob Marcan

Hi.

RHEL 4.4
cyrus-imapd-2.2.12-3.RHEL4.1
postfix-2.2.10-1.RHEL4.2


From the maillog:
May 17 10:41:06 populus2 postfix/lmtp[15309]: 0F776840280:
to=[EMAIL PROTECTED], orig_to=[EMAIL PROTECTED],
relay=/var/lib/imap/socket/lmtp[/var/lib/imap/socket/lmtp], delay=1421,
status=deferred
(host /var/lib/imap/socket/lmtp[/var/lib/imap/socket/lmtp] said: 451
4.3.0 System I/O error (in reply to RCPT TO command))

May 17 10:41:06 populus2 lmtpunix[15310]: DBERROR: error fetching
user.avucajnk: cyrusdb error


cyradm:
 lm  user.avucajnk.*
 sam  user.avucajnk cyrus all
 lam user.avucajnk
 dm user.avucajnk
 cm user.avucajnk
 cm user.avucajnk.Drafts
 cm user.avucajnk.Junk
 cm user.avucajnk.Sent
 cm user.avucajnk.Trash
cyradm delete and create mailboxes without problem.

But i got the same messages again.


su - cyrus -c /usr/lib/cyrus-imapd/ctl_mboxlist -d
...
user.avucajnk   default avucajnklrswipcda   
user.avucajnk.Draftsdefault avucajnk
lrswipcda user.avucajnk.Junkdefault avucajnk
lrswipcda user.avucajnk.Sentdefault avucajnk
lrswipcda user.avucajnk.Trash   default avucajnk
lrswipcda   
...
Looks good.

Which DB except /var/lib/imap/mailboxes.db is involved here.
This user is the only one which make problems.
Does anybody have an idea?

TIA, Bob

-- 
 Bob Marcan, Consultantmailto:[EMAIL PROTECTED]
 ST Slovenija d.d.tel:   +386 (1) 5895-300
 Leskoskova cesta 6fax:   +386 (1) 5895-202
 1000 Ljubljana, Slovenia  url:   http://www.snt.si


Cyrus Home Page: http://cyrusimap.web.cmu.edu/
Cyrus Wiki/FAQ: http://cyrusimap.web.cmu.edu/twiki
List Archives/Info: http://asg.web.cmu.edu/cyrus/mailing-list.html